Window and Door Servicing: Essential Insights for Homeowners

Windows and doors play a substantial role in the looks, security, and energy effectiveness of a home. Regular servicing is important not just to maintain their functionality however also to extend their lifespan and enhance their performance. In this article, we will check out why servicing windows and doors is crucial, the common issues associated, the advantages of regular maintenance, and suggestions on how to carry out these services efficiently.

Significance of Window and Door Servicing

Servicing windows and doors offers several crucial benefits:

  1. Enhanced Energy Efficiency: Properly serviced doors and windows can reduce energy expenses by preventing drafts and guaranteeing airtight seals.

  2. Increased Security: Regular assessments and maintenance aid determine weaknesses or damages that might jeopardize the security of a home.

  3. Enhanced Aesthetic Appeal: Well-maintained doors and windows maintain their appearance, contributing positively to the general look of a home.

  4. Increased Lifespan: Regular servicing assists determine and solve issues before they intensify, ultimately extending the life of the doors and windows.

  5. Area Problems Early: Servicing can assist house owners capture issues such as decaying frames, harmed seals, and misaligned hinges before they need costly repairs.

Common Window and Door Problems

House owners typically face numerous issues with windows and doors, each necessitating specific servicing strategies. Below are some common issues:

ProblemDescriptionRecommended Action
DraftsAir leaks around the frame.Reseal or change weather condition stripping.
Problem OpeningWindows or doors may stick or jam.Lube hinges and tracks.
CondensationExcess wetness inside the panes.Examine for seal failures; consider replacement.
Split or Broken GlassDeteriorating glass panels.Repair or replace glass as required.
Deformed FramesFrame misalignment due to weather or age.Adjust or replace deformed frames.
Rotted WoodDegeneration due to moisture direct exposure.Repair or replace damaged areas.

Benefits of Regular Window and Door Maintenance

Routinely servicing and maintaining doors and windows can cause a wide variety of benefits. Here is a detailed summary:

  • Cost Savings: Preventing concerns through routine maintenance can conserve property owners substantial expenses associated with repairs and replacements.

  • Comfort: Well-functioning windows and doors provide convenience by ensuring adequate ventilation and insulation.

  • Much Better Indoor Air Quality: Prevents mold development and boosts indoor air quality by minimizing wetness accumulation.

  • Home Value: A home with well-kept doors and windows generally has a greater property value.

  • Noise Reduction: Properly sealed doors and windows can likewise minimize the invasion of outdoors sound, adding to a more peaceful environment.

How to Service Windows and Doors

Servicing windows and doors is a job that property owners can undertake themselves with a bit of knowledge and the right tools. Below is an easy guide to servicing windows and doors efficiently:

Tools and Materials Needed

  • Screwdriver set
  • Lubricant (silicone or oil-based)
  • Weather removing
  • Cleaning products (glass cleaner, fabrics, etc)
  • Caulk and caulking gun
  • Replacement parts (if necessary)

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Examine: Thoroughly examine doors and windows for any signs of wear, damage, or degeneration.

  2. Clean: Wash the frames and glass using proper cleaners.

  3. Lube: Apply lubricant to all moving parts, consisting of hinges, locks, and tracks.

  4. Check Seals and Weather Stripping: Replace old, damaged weather condition stripping and inspect seals for leakages.

  5. Change Hardware: Ensure that all hardware (latches, knobs, hinges) are effectively aligned and functional.

  6. Repair or Replace: Address any issues discovered during the assessment, whether through repairs or by ordering replacement parts.

  7. Final Check: After servicing, observe how windows and doors function. Make needed modifications as needed.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

What are the indications that my doors and windows need servicing?

Common indications include drafts, problem opening or closing, visible damage (fractures, rot), and condensation on the glass.

Can I service my doors and windows myself, or should I hire an expert?

Many property owners can perform standard servicing jobs themselves. Nevertheless, for significant repairs or replacements, employing a professional is advisable.

How often should I service my windows and doors?

It is generally suggested to service windows and doors at least when a year, with additional checks after extreme weather.

Will regular servicing truly save me money on energy expenses?

Yes, by ensuring your windows and doors are sealed effectively and operating efficiently, you can lower energy expenses significantly.

What should I do if I find significant damage throughout inspection?

If you find considerable damage, such as decomposing frames or broken seals, consult an expert for repair or replacement choices.
